Illuvium sets the stage for beta 4 testing

User Avatar

As the Illuvium universe prepares to unfold, this highly anticipated blockchain gaming series has announced its Beta 4 testing schedule, starting with Private Beta 4 on April 30, 2024. The launch will include a pre-registration campaign and the introduction of the rewarding ‘Play-2-Airdrop incentives aimed at refining gameplay ahead of official launch.

Starting with Private Beta 4

Private Beta 4, scheduled from April 30 to May 28, 2024, represents an important phase in Illuvium’s development. This period offers fewer than 10,000 selected players – the “lucky rangers” – their first glimpse of the full run of the game on Testnet. These players, chosen from Illuvium’s active community and through marketing efforts, will test key features such as passport integration, asset minting, Illuvidex trading, fuel purchasing and travel mechanics.

Player feedback will be invaluable, in hopes of resolving key issues and ensuring a polished transition into the Open Beta Testnet phase. Illuvium rewards participants with the first Airdrop points as a token of appreciation.

According to Illuvium, players who would like to join the private Testnet and earn Airdrop Points must pre-register by April 15, 2024. This will give them an exclusive chance to play before the Open Testnet phase begins.

Transition to Open Beta Testnet

After Private Beta 4, the Open Beta Testnet phase will begin on May 28, 2024. All players will be welcomed via the Epic Games launcher for a testing period expected to last 2-4 weeks. This phase is crucial for final adjustments before the public launch, and participants are also eligible for Airdrop Points. 10% of the Play-2-Airdrop $ILV pool will be allocated for these Testnet phases, with the initial Airdrop payout capping this period.

The transition to the Open Beta Mainnet will culminate in rigorous stress testing and system evaluations. By allocating the remaining 90% of the Play-2-Airdrop $ILV pool for this phase, Illuvium aims to continue improving all four games post-launch and introducing new features to enrich the player experience.

Play for Airdrop: a rewarding experience

Earning airdrop points is simple: the more you play, the more points you collect across all three games, priming players to share in the $ILV bounty for six months. An upcoming dashboard will allow participants to track their accumulated points, simplifying the process as the open beta approaches.

With a recent $12 million Series A funding, Illuvium Labs aims to bring the interconnected Illuvium Arena, Illuvium Overworld and Illuvium Zero games to life. Built on the Ethereum ecosystem and utilizing the Immutable X network, these titles promise a new era of interoperable blockchain gaming.
